WebJul 26, 2011 · The FCC’s cell tower safety regulations need to be revised immediately because: 1) WHO has classified RF Radiation as a “Possible Carcinogen” … WebThe FCC's policies on RF exposure and categorical exclusion can be found in Section 1.1307(b) of the FCC's Rules and Regulations [47 CFR 1.1307(b)]. It should be emphasized, however, that these exclusions are not exclusions from compliance, but, rather, only exclusions from routine evaluation. ... At a given cell site, the total RF power that ...

Woodland Park’s city attorney agreed and read the FCC law to remind council that they could not ban the tower based on environmental … potes infantisWebIn order to facilitate faster deployment of wireless infrastructure, the rules now expand that categorical exclusion to include: equipment associated with the antennas (such as wires, cables, and backup-power equipment), certain deployments on existing utility poles and electric transmission towers, and collocations within a building. potes au top fortniteWebThe FCC is pursuing a comprehensive strategy to facilitate U.S. 5G deployment. This strategy includes three key components: pushing more spectrum into the marketplace; updating infrastructure policy; and modernizing outdated regulations. For more information, see the FCC web page: America's 5G Future.
